This is the first time in the history of the Bertel Award, which was established in 1967, that it will be presented to an officer of any military branch.

Capt. Rochon is an active member of the WTC Transportation Committee. A native of New Orleans and a graduate of Xavier University of Louisiana and the National Defense University in Washington, D.C., Capt. Rochon enlisted in the Coast Guard in 1970 and rose through the ranks during a distinguished career, culminating in his present assignment as Captain of the Port of New Orleans and Commanding Officer of the Marine Safety Office in New Orleans. In these capacities, Capt. Rochon was the Federal-on-Scene Coordinator and exercised superior leadership last November during the prompt and successful cleanup of the massive spill of over 13,000 barrels of crude oil in the Mississippi River created by the tanker Westchester. It was one of the largest domestic spills by a tanker since the Exxon Valdez incident.

The award is named after C. Alvin Bertel, who was instrumental in bringing about a constitutional amendment which provided for the non-political selection of Port commissioners in the early 1940s. In its early years, the newly formed Board of Commissioners instituted administrative reforms which have endured to this day.

Past Recipients

1967: Hon. John J. McKeithen
1968: George S. Dinwiddie
1969: Robert R. Barkerding, Sr.
1970: Jerome L. Goldman & Erik F. Johnsen
1971: Hon. F. Edward Hebert
1972: Richard B. Montgomery
1973: Hon. James E. Fitzmorris
1974: A. C. Cocke
1975: James E. Smith
1976: W. James Amoss, Jr.
1977: Frank G. Strachan
1978: James G. Howell
1979: Mayor Ernest N. Morial
1980: John Meghrian
1981: Edward S. Reed
1982: Sam Israel, Jr.
1983: Philip G. Kuehn
1984: Joseph J. Krebs, Jr.
1985: James J. Coleman, Sr.
1986: Hon. Francis E. Lauricella
1987: Capt. Jacques B. Michell
1988: J. Ron Brinson
1989: Susan Wingfield
1990: Basil J. Rusovich, Jr.
1991: George Duffy
1992: Hon. J. Bennett Johnston, Jr.
1995: Capt. William A. Slatten, Sr.
1996: Robert G. Evans, Sr.
1997: Donald "Boysie" Bollinger
1999: Capt. Mark Delesdernier, Jr
2000: John P. Laborde
